A number of Louise's ideal operate came about due to her friendship Along with the American painter and poet Marsden Hartley, who lived with her parents and painted in Corea from 1940 right up until his Dying in September 1943. Afterward, throughout WWII, Louise worked for that Bachrach Studio wherever she was in command of their darkroom.

He begun his cafe and gallery accidentally. His aunt was Louise Z. Younger, a Massachusetts photographer who left her collection of negatives to Young when she died in 2004. The gathering depicted everyday living within the nineteen forties through sixties in Down East Maine. Youthful printed a variety and converted the workshop on his wharf into a bit gallery. Which was in 2009. Hardly any person came.

Considering that then, the organization has added a food stuff stand that serves a menu consisting of lobster rolls to steak and cheese to Gifford's ice cream. In the summer season you might have lunch about the wharf from eleven-five on a daily basis, climate allowing.
